Additional Resources Related to Managing Diversity

Global Perspectives - Australian Centre for International Business: Diversity Management: “The Australian Centre for International Business is eclectic in its interdisciplinary areas, studying the international aspects of strategy and management, human resource management, industrial relations, corporate history, accounting, finance, information systems, organizational behavior and marketing…It continues to deliver leading edge international business research, teaching and consultancy. The Programme for the Practice of Diversity Management is a collaborative arrangement between the Department of Immigration and Multicultural Affairs (DIMA) and the Australian Centre for International Business (ACIB) funded through DIMA's Productive Diversity Partnership Programme.”

Retrieve business models, toolkits, and the Centre’s Business Case for Diversity Management here: http://wff2.ecom.unimelb.edu.au/acib/diverse/home.html.

Best Practices in Achieving Workforce Diversity: ”This benchmarking study from 2000 was released by the U.S. Department of Commerce and Al Gore’s National Partnership for Reinventing Government. “The findings in this report illustrate that the benefits of diversity are for everyone. Diversity is more than a moral imperative; it is a global necessity. Moreover, diversity is an essential component of any civil society.”
